Detalles del Curso
โข Electric Aircraft Software Fundamentals: Understanding the basics of electric aircraft software, including the differences between traditional and electric aircraft systems.
โข Aircraft Electrification Technologies: Exploring the latest technologies in electric propulsion, energy storage, and power management for aircraft.
โข Software Development Processes: Learning established software development practices, including Agile and DevOps, and how they apply to electric aircraft software.
โข Safety-Critical Systems: Understanding the unique challenges of safety-critical systems in electric aircraft software development, such as certification and redundancy.
โข Real-Time Systems and Embedded Software: Developing skills in real-time systems and embedded software, critical in electric aircraft control and monitoring.
โข Model-Based Design and Simulation: Utilizing model-based design and simulation tools to develop, test, and validate electric aircraft software.
โข Cybersecurity for Electric Aircraft: Addressing cybersecurity threats in electric aircraft software, including secure communication and system protection.
โข Regulations and Standards: Familiarizing with aviation regulations and standards for electric aircraft software development, such as DO-178C and ED-202A.
โข Software Testing and Verification: Mastering software testing and verification techniques to ensure the safety, reliability, and efficiency of electric aircraft software.
